Transaction e384c968f44459757589e5a93f188138cea76f118fa87a8fd57afa8704837ead

1 Input
2 Outputs
  • e384c968f44459757589e5a93f188138cea76f118fa87a8fd57afa8704837ead:0
  • value  89999817175
    address  16xHDNz8qqie9vW2pBFDJ9k3rpDGG1yrtQ
  • e384c968f44459757589e5a93f188138cea76f118fa87a8fd57afa8704837ead:1
  • value  10000000000
    address  17LNVBq8W9Vdx2Ub94BRgecTFeQkd1UAXc